Webb8 okt. 2024 · On the eve of the next decade, Vintage 2024 population estimates show the nation’s growth continues to slow: the U.S. population is at 328.2 million, up 0.48% since July 2024. Growth has slowed every year since 2015, when the population increased 0.73% relative to the previous year.
